The USS Shrimp (SP-645) was a United States Navy patrol vessel active during World War I, serving from 1917 to 1918. Originally constructed as a private motorboat, the vessel was built in 1912 by the Gas Engine and Power Company located at Morris Heights in the Bronx, New York. The boat was owned by H. W. D. Rudd of Boston, Massachusetts, prior to her acquisition by the Navy. In May 1917, the U.S. Navy acquired the vessel for wartime service, and she was officially commissioned as USS Shrimp (SP-645) in August 1917. As a patrol craft, she was primarily assigned to harbor patrol duties within Boston Harbor, ensuring security and monitoring maritime activity in the area. Additionally, she performed local escort duties in the Boston vicinity, supporting naval operations and safeguarding shipping lanes. Throughout her service, the USS Shrimp encountered several misadventures. She was twice reported lost at sea, indicating the hazards faced during her patrol missions, and was nearly destroyed by fire at one point. Despite these incidents, she survived and continued her patrol duties, demonstrating resilience. Later in her service, she was reassigned to night patrol duties at the Fore River Shipyard in Quincy, Massachusetts, but was soon recalled to her original role in Boston Harbor. The vessel was decommissioned shortly after the end of World War I on November 30, 1918, and returned to her owner, Rudd, in February 1919.
